In this vivid anthology the author gathers letters, short narratives, and poems spoken in the plain‑spoken Low German of Westphalia. The pieces capture everyday life on the rural pastures, from hearty humor to the humble wisdom that shaped the community’s rituals and seasonal chores. Every idiom and proverb is presented with careful footnotes, letting modern ears hear the original phrasing while still understanding its meaning.
The language is intentionally raw and unvarnished, preserving the sturdy rhythm and occasional coarse expressions of the older generation before the sweeping changes of the nineteenth century. Through vivid anecdotes and lyrical verses, listeners get a snapshot of how the land, the church, and village gatherings intertwined with speech. It serves both as a cultural time capsule and a lively listening experience for anyone curious about the texture of historic German dialects.
